Online examination system is a web-based examination system where examination is taken online i.e. through the internet or intranet using computer system. It is an effective solution for mass education evaluation. We have developed an online examination system based on a Browser/Server framework using Microsoft Visual Studio 2008 for the design, C# 3.5 for coding, and Microsoft SQL Server as database. ASP.NET is the preferred web technology. The system carries out the examination and auto-grading for multiple choice questions which is feed into the system.KEY WORDS: Online, Examination, System, Auto-grading, Web-based.

A systemic approach to identifying road locations that exhibit safety problems was provided by the Safety Needs Identification Program (SNIP and SNIP2) developed by the Purdue University Center for Road Safety (CRS). The new version SNIP Light has been developed to provide other uses with planning level traffic safety analysis capability for a wider range of uses including Metropolitan Planning Agencies (MPOs) who want the tool for planning cost-effective safety programs in their metropolitan areas. The SNIP Light reduces the demand of computing and data storage resources and replaces the SQL server database system an integrated module coded in-house which is considerably faster than the original component. Furthermore, certain proficiency required to install and use the old version is no longer needed thanks to the intuitive single-window interface and executing file operations in the background without the user’s involvement. Some operations, such as optimizing funding of safety projects, are removed to simplify the tool.

This case study examines the results of an effort by a large regionally accredited institution to assure the integrity of its online final examination process. The question of whether the student outcomes achieved when administering an entirely online final exam are comparable to the outcomes achieved when administering proctored final exams for online (e-learning) university classes is the primary focus of this study. The results of an analysis of over 100 online courses and 1800 students indicate that it is possible to establish processes and procedures that allow the results achieved by students on their final exam to be comparable irrespective of whether the final exam is proctored or is a fully online examination.
